    For an easy kid friendly trail you can take Downtown from the main lodge down into town. It's about 5 miles, all singletrack, mostly very easy, but it is pretty much the same the entire way down (gets a little old).

    For a much more fun trail that would still be doable if your kids have a little skill would be to take the gondola up and take the easiest trail down. I think it's called "Off the Top". It's an intermediate xc type trail. Nearly all downhill if you take one of the cutoffs and hop on the Kamikaze for a short bit when you get closer to the bottom. There's a lot of variety on that trail and would be a blast for your kids.
